How does Belize produce energy?
Belize’s Indigenous Energy Production by Primary Energy Content in 2016. Belize imports majority of the secondary energy that it consumes, including electricity from the interconnection with Mexico’s CFE. Belize’s secondary energy supply was evidently dominated by imported oil products (Figure 3).
What is the main goal of Belize's energy strategy?
The main goal of Belize's energy strategy is to achieve a low-carbon community by 2033. This strategy establishes a framework for transitioning Belize’s energy sector and recommends programs and action plans through improved energy efficiency and conservation measures as well as increased development of the country’s renewable energy resources.
What is the indigenous energy supply in Belize?
Figure 2 depicts the indigenous energy supply in Belize by primary energy content. In 2016, Crude Oil accounted for 13% (574.91 TJ) of indigenous energy production and Petroleum Gas accounted for 1.4% (62.93 TJ). Renewables made up the remaining 85.60% of primary energy supply,
What is Belize's national energy policy?
Belize’s National Energy Policy (NEP, 2012) sets out the basic principles and strategies for integrating energy more deeply into Belize’s development. An integral component of Belize’s national development agenda is to develop strong sustainable energy policies and programmes that underpin the national economy.
What are the renewable energy resources in Belize?
Belize has good to moderate land-based wind resources (Class 3–4). Full solar and biomass resource assessments are unavailable. The country's current hydroelectric capacity includes 25.5 MW at the Mollejon Hydro Plant, 7.0 MW at the Chalillo Hydroelectric Dam Plant, 19 MW at the Vaca Hydroelectric Facilities, and 3.5 MW at the HydroMaya Dam.
